Visitors must not enter the Larkspur Studio while recording is in progress — check the red lamp first. Team assistants booking the studio for trainers should log the session in the wall sheet and keep guests in the annexe. Enter using the door-pass code below.

door code, kahap-kawip: bdg-XUDDCY-22034334

Visitors at the Brennick House office may use the roof terrace only when accompanied by a staff member. Note that the terrace door has been jamming since the spring resealing work; push firmly at the top corner while turning the handle. If a visitor gets stuck outside, unlock the override panel using the code below.

turnstile pass: bdg-FVNQRS-72965873

Handover — Night Access, Support Team (Orrin Works)

New starters: support covers the overnight window from the Level 2 pod. Main doors lock at 21:30. Enter via the north stair; badge the reader twice if it flashes amber. Don't prop doors — alarms page the duty manager. Break room stays open; server corridor does not. Radios charge by the whiteboard, take one per shift. Log every entry after midnight in the book. The north stair door code you'll need is below.

staff pass of yahag-tagaf = bdg-NGQCI-9

## Authentication

So you want your plugin to talk to Tidybarn, our orphaned-resource sweeper? Cool — just know it's picky. Every call to the sweep API needs a plugin-scoped credential; anonymous requests get a 401 and a mildly judgmental log line. Don't reuse keys across plugins, and don't hardcode them in published packages — the Brindlehoff registry scanner will flag you. Scopes are read-only by default; ask for sweep:execute if you really need it. Your sandbox key for the internal sweep endpoint is below.

gateway credential: kto23_LX9A4ys6i4nzHtpOLNLodKK

## Tuning the shards

Heads-up: ProfileVault splits user profiles across shards by a salted hash, so hot accounts can't pile onto one node. Rebalancing is throttled on purpose — moving profiles too fast widens the window where a record exists in two places, which matters for your audit. We keep replication and migration knobs deliberately conservative, and nothing here touches encryption settings. The defaults we ship, and recommend you verify, are below.

tuning constants:
RATE_LIMITS = {
    "wenwyn": 1,
    "zorix": 10,
    "oliix": 2,
    "holael": 10,
}